Raisins sterilizing unit
Technical field
The utility model relates to raisins sterilization processing technical fields, are a kind of raisins sterilizing units.
Background technique
The Food Packaging Production Line of the dry fruits such as current existing raisins, jujube usually will be to it before dry fruit packaging Sterilization processing is carried out, traditional sterilizing methods are time-consuming and laborious, and sterilization effect is bad, since the type of dry fruit is more, shape And different sizes, the processing that each position of dry fruit is subject to are difficult to accomplish uniformity, cause sterilization to be not thorough, to affect The quality of dry fruit.

Embodiment: as shown in Figure 1, the raisins sterilizing unit includes that rack 1, shield 2, conveyer belt apparatus, ultraviolet light kill Bacterium lamp device and turn-down rig, 1 top of rack are equipped with conveyer belt apparatus, and conveyer belt apparatus includes active belt roller 3, driven belt roller 4 and conveyer belt, the left part and right part of conveyer belt be set on active belt roller 3 and driven belt roller 4, active belt roller 3 and driven The conveyer belt of 4 top of belt roller is formed along horizontally disposed top material-conveying belt 5, the conveyer belt of 4 lower section of active belt roller 3 and driven belt roller Form lower part material-conveying belt;The top of corresponding top material-conveying belt 5 is equipped with shield 2, and the rear end of shield 2 is hinged in rack 1, shield 2 Inner cavity top ultraviolet sterilizing lamp device is installed, the inner cavity lower part of shield 2 is equipped with the turn-down rig with material rotating plate 6, stirring The length direction of plate 6 arranges that the upper surface of material rotating plate 6 is guiding surface 7, described along the working width direction of top material-conveying belt 5 The inclined direction of guiding surface 7 is to tilt along 5 direction of motion of top material-conveying belt and obliquely, the lower end of material rotating plate 6 with it is upper Flitch gap is formed between the upper surface of portion's material-conveying belt 5.Ultraviolet sterilizing lamp device, which can give off, is enough to destroy virus and thin The ultraviolet light of DNA in born of the same parents can kill bacterium, virus and other microorganisms, or cause it to lose its activity, lose fertility, also The immune microorganism of some pairs of other modes can be killed to be usually used at present so as to realize the purpose of effectively sterilization, disinfection Disinfection to empty gas and water and body surface.But due to being influenced by ultraviolet light penetration capacity, only had by the surface of sterilised object The effect that can be only achieved sterilizing on one side of direct irradiation, therefore existing ultraviolet sterilization apparatus can not be realized efficiently pair The effective sterilization and disinfection of dry fruit all surfaces.For the utility model by setting turn-down rig, the length dimension of material rotating plate 6 is best Less than or equal to the working width of top material-conveying belt 5, when reality carries out the sterilization treatment before the food packaging of dry fruit, top conveying When encountering material rotating plate 6 in conveying with the whole dry fruits conveyed on 5, it can continue to move ahead along the guiding surface 7 of material rotating plate 6, Each dry fruit falls turn when reaching the left end of material rotating plate 6, in this way, just reliably guaranteeing while fast speed conveys dry fruit Each grain dry fruit effectively rolls, overturns and changes face, so that it is guaranteed that each face of dry fruit is equably by the ultraviolet light of doses Irradiation effectively, uniformity realizes the sterilization and disinfection of dry fruit overall surface, to significantly improve the quality of dry fruit.
As shown in Fig. 1-3, the front outsides of shield 2 are equipped with no less than one handle 43, in the top inner wall of shield 2 No less than two ultraviolet sterilizing lamp devices are installed, down ultraviolet sterilizing lamp is installed on each ultraviolet sterilizing lamp device The axis direction of pipe 8, the down ultraviolet sterilizing lamp pipe 8 is consistent with the direction of motion of top material-conveying belt 5 and adjacent Two ultraviolet sterilizing lamp devices are set in distance in the direction of motion along top material-conveying belt 5, and turn-down rig is located at adjacent Between two ultraviolet sterilizing lamp devices.Shield 2 can be easily opened by handle 43, is filled by multiple ultraviolet germicidal lamps Sterilization and disinfection can be better achieved by setting, and down ultraviolet sterilizing lamp pipe 8 is arranged in left-right direction can be in dry fruit traveling Extend irradiation time in the process, multiple turn-down rigs are set, dry fruit stirs that effect is more preferable, and irradiation ultraviolet light is more uniform.
As shown in Fig. 1,4, material rotating plate 6 is the tri-prismoid of the rectangular triangle in section, and the left side of material rotating plate 6 is vertical Plane, the lower end surface of material rotating plate 6 are plane in the horizontal direction, and the angle ɑ of guiding surface 7 and 6 lower end surface of material rotating plate is 15 degree To 38 degree, the height dimension H in flitch gap is 1.5 millimeters to 3.5 millimeters.The left side of material rotating plate 6 is perpendicular, and dry fruit is fallen Turn effect when lower is more preferable, and dry fruit is blocked by being not susceptible to when material rotating plate 6 when angle ɑ is 15 degree to 38 degree after tested, when Angle ɑ is got over hour, and dry fruit is more smooth by the guiding surface 7 of material rotating plate 6, but tumbling effect is weaker, in addition it is also necessary to root According to parameters such as the skin friction resistance characteristic of various different dry fruits, the average diameter sizes of dry fruit, suitable angle ɑ is selected.

As shown in Figure 1, 2, ultraviolet sterilizing lamp device includes lamp tube installation rack 30, ultraviolet ray lamp electronic ballast 31 and kills Bacterium lamp switch 32, lamp tube installation rack 30 are fixedly mounted at the top of the inner wall of shield 2, and down ultraviolet sterilizing lamp pipe 8 is fixedly mounted On lamp tube installation rack 30, ultraviolet ray lamp electronic ballast is being fixedly installed on 2 inner wall of shield of 30 right of lamp tube installation rack 31, the rack 1 of corresponding 2 front position of shield is equipped with the sterilization lamp switch 32 that shield 2 can be made to disconnect when opening, in rack 1 Equipped with regulated power supply converter and it is connected with attaching plug, down ultraviolet sterilizing lamp pipe 8 passes through lamp tube installation rack 30, ultraviolet light Lamp electronic ballast 31, sterilization lamp switch 32 and conducting wire are electrically connected with regulated power supply converter, and the front lower ends of shield 2 are pressed against On sterilization lamp switch 32 and sterilization lamp switch 32 closure, down ultraviolet sterilizing lamp pipe 8 can be made to be powered on.Covering shield After 2, sterilization lamp switch 32 is closed, and the energization of down ultraviolet sterilizing lamp pipe 8 can be realized the quick sterilization of dry fruit before encapsulation Disinfection, when opening shield 2, sterilization lamp switch 32 can disconnect in time, power off down ultraviolet sterilizing lamp pipe 8 in time, thus Unexpected injury of the ultraviolet light to service personnel or operator is avoided, use is more safe and reliable.In actual use, each ultraviolet light kills Bacterium lamp device is preferably selected the lamp tube installation rack 30 that can install two down ultraviolet sterilizing lamp pipes 8, the spoke of such ultraviolet light It is higher to penetrate intensity, corresponding sterilization and disinfection are also preferable.
According to actual needs, ultraviolet ray lamp electronic ballast 31 is RL1-800-100 type, down ultraviolet sterilizing lamp pipe 8 For Philip TUV36T5HO type.The output electric current of RL1-800-100 type ultraviolet ray lamp electronic ballast 31 is steadily reliable, anti-electricity Source fluctuation ability is preferable, and Philip TUV36T5HO type down ultraviolet sterilizing lamp pipe 8 can emit short wave ultraviolet (UV-C), Stay in grade is reliable, and long service life, sterilizing ability are very strong, can be used to effectively sterilize dry fruit surface.
